Track Work Out-of-Doors Daily

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

The track team is having daily practice on Soldiers Field. For the distance men a track has been improvised underneath the Stadium. The sprinters, hurdlers and the candidates for the broad jump have been running on the sidewalks along the side of the field. Mr. Quinn has been coaching daily the men who are trying for the weight events.

Owing to the fact that the first meet will be held in about two weeks, it is essential that this work be carried on at present, in order to put the men into condition for doing the hard work which will be begun as soon as the track is cleared.
